What To Look For In A Good Golf Course Builder

By Carolyn Jones


The construction of a beautiful golf course requires coordination with different professionals. All these professionals should be able to work together to achieve the required result. Maintenance of the golf course is also as important to maintain its aesthetics and also increase its beauty to the public. Choosing a good company to enable you to come up with a good field requires much careful selection. This article provides for the things to consider before selecting an ideal golf course builder.

The professionals in the company. Coming up with a playing field requires different experts to bring up their ideas for effective results. The experts include architects, landscape architects, planners and several others. A company should have several providers as this will increase the probability to achieve the required outcome.

The firm should possess post services after construction. Golf fields require proper maintenance after its completion. Vegetation within the field should be maintained to enhance the general beauty of the field as time goes by. The plants and grass need to be pruned and irrigated. One should choose a venture that provides these services as it contributes to cutting the cost of maintenance and save time in looking for another company that will offer the same services.

The price in relation the service offered. The price is important in selecting an ideal firm. The builder that offer costly services may not be affordable even if they are providing good services. The cost should be standard to the market price. On the other hand, some companies may be seen to offer services at meager prices, but one should be careful to check on the quality of their work.

The company should be well reputed. This includes the general view of the public about a company. The nature of work provided by the builder should be cross-checked and confirm whether there was customer satisfaction. Companies with a positive reputation increase the trust to work with.

The duration the firm has been in the field of construction. Preparing a course requires experience. The company that been on the field for long will most likely provide better results than new companies that have come up. One can track the record of a long stayed business and be able to gauge its performance.

The company must have the relevant permits and insurances. Licenses enable the company to provide services as per the legal stipulation. The insurance is supposed to cover for any future damages that may happen when making of the field. An insured and licensed company creates a feeling of security since one is also able to make future follow up.

Location of the firm. Locally available companies are easier to work with as someone can easily approach them in case of any arising issues. Far away enterprises will increase traveling costs and make it expensive, and in that case, one may opt for online communication via email which reduces trust.
